Marionnaud was founded in 1972 in France by Bernard Marionnaud, who had a revolutionary idea: to create places where beauty is accessible to everyone.

The Group entered the Italian market in 2000 and today operates more than 1,000 stores across 8 European countries:
Italy, France, Romania, Switzerland, Austria, Hungary, the Czech Republic, and Slovakia.

We’re looking for a Demand Planning Manager to join our team in Milan. At Marionnaud, we know that great customer experience starts long before the customer enters the store — it starts with having the right product, in the right place, at the right time. We are looking for a Demand Planning Manager who will lead this critical mission and play a central role in connecting commercial ambition with operational excellence.

This is not just a planning role. You will be responsible for driving demand planning, stock optimization and service level performance, directly impacting sales, availability and working capital — while leading a team and shaping the way we operate. You will sit at the intersection of Supply Chain, Trade, Retail, Finance, and E-commerce, ensuring alignment between commercial priorities and execution.

What you will do

Lead and continuously improve the demand planning process, ensuring accurate forecasts and strong decision‑making

Own inventory strategy and stock optimization, balancing availability and cost efficiency

Manage and develop a team, ensuring focus, performance, and capability growth

Monitor and improve service levels in stores (OSA) and overall product availability

Drive actions on slow‑moving stock and improve inventory rotation

Translate demand plans into effective purchasing and replenishment strategies

Partner with Trade and suppliers to ensure the right assortment and support commercial initiatives

Coordinate with logistics providers to ensure efficiency in warehouse and transport operations

Support key business moments: product launches, peak periods, and new store openings

Deliver clear insights and reporting on key KPIs (forecast accuracy, stock coverage, inventory turnover, OSA)

Ideal candidate

Combines strong analytical skills with business understanding

Has experience in Demand Planning / Supply Chain / Inventory Management

Is comfortable leading people and influencing without authority

Thinks both strategically and operationally

Enjoys improving processes and driving change

Works effectively in a fast‑paced, cross‑functional environment

What we’re looking for

5+ years’ experience in Supply Chain / Demand Planning (with team management experience)

Strong expertise in forecasting, inventory management and supply chain processes

Advanced analytical capability and data‑driven mindset

Strong stakeholder management and communication skills

Fluent English

We offer a competitive compensation package aligned with seniority and experience, typically in the €52,000–€60,000 gross annual salary range, plus a performance‑related bonus.
